Transaction 67ac564c8e6e873094a00be1fb4f927b1d46aec62f0d1703fc7746b1ebf633aa
1 Input
1 Output
-
67ac564c8e6e873094a00be1fb4f927b1d46aec62f0d1703fc7746b1ebf633aa:0
- value
- 1326922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81a46b6006dadede6dc41e4ddeb021c11c70a0b OP_EQUAL
- address
- 3JUTjYW6p43KETqSS8E3vzr7tfbEGwgaSr